Elevation 1550

2008 Mount Veeder, Napa Valley Cabernet Sauvignon

Mount Veeder Winery Elevation 1550 is a stunning Cabernet Sauvignon from the renowned Napa Valley region, showcasing the majestic character of the Mount Veeder appellation. This 2008 vintage presents a deep, alluring red color that foreshadows its depth and complexity. On the palate, the wine reveals a full-bodied structure complemented by high acidity, which brings a bright, mouthwatering quality to the experience. The fruit intensity is prominent, with luscious notes of blackcurrant and dark cherry harmonizing beautifully with subtle undertones of oak and spice. The tannins are notable and firm, providing a solid backbone that promises great aging potential. This Cabernet Sauvignon is expertly crafted, with a bone-dry finish that leaves a lasting impression, making it an exceptional choice for connoisseurs seeking a wine that reflects the unique terroir of Mount Veeder.
